It’s rare to see the Little Sisters outside of their nursing homes, where they lovingly care for the elderly poor as they have since their order came to the United States in 1868. Their presence at the State of the Union offered a striking reminder of the religious order’s robust legacy in this country, but also of the powerful forces that prompted them to file a legal challenge to take the federal government to court.
